What are 2 powers that belong only to the Senate?

Answers

The Senate is vested with the sole authority to confirm all those appointments made by the President and to act as jury for impeachment proceedings.

The senate is given the power to decide whether a certain appointment to the government, be it in the position of a civil servant or a judge, is valid or not.

This acts as a check on the powers of the President as the appointments to public offices run a scrutiny test by the Senators.

Further, when any official is called in after an impeachment motion runs in favor of him/her, the Senate acts as the judge and the jury at the same time to hear the impeachment proceedings.

They are presented with all evidence, relevant witnesses and other materials that help them pass their verdict in the form of votes. This will decide the discharge or conviction of the impeached official.

What is a presidential power that requires approval from the Senate?

Answers

The presidential power that requires approval from the Senate is the treaty power.

According to the American Constitution, the president "shall have Power, by and with the Advice and Consent of the Senate, to make Treaties, provided two-thirds of the Senators present concur". This is specified in Article II, Section 2 of the Constitution.

Treaties are defined as agreements between two or more nations that have a legally binding effect. They also get included under the umbrella of international law.

In effect, a treaty to which United States has ratified and become a party to will have the force of federal legislation. It becomes a part of what is known as ''the supreme Law of the Land.''

Recently, the trend is more towards, presidents entering the United States into international agreements without the Senate's consent or advice.

However these are not treaties but  "executive agreements." It shall be noted that executive agreements also have a binding effect under international law

What are the two types of political action committees?

Answers

Political action committees (PACs) include separate segregated funds (SSFs), non-connected groups, and super PACs.

SSFs are political organisations that are created and run by businesses, labour unions, membership groups, or trade associations. Only those affiliated to a related or sponsoring organisation may make a gift to these committees.

Contrarily, non-connected committees are allowed to ask for donations from the general public since, as their name implies, they are not affiliated with or sponsored by any of the aforementioned organisations.

Super PACs (political groups with independent spending solely) and hybrid PACs (political committees with non-contribution accounts)

In order to finance independent expenditures and other independent political action, super PACs (independent expenditure only political committees) are groups that may accept an unlimited amount of contributions from people, businesses, labour organisations, and other PACs.

What is the role of the Department of Homeland Security when was it created and by which President?

Answers

President George W. Bush established the Office of Homeland Security in the wake of the September 11 attacks in 2001 to coordinate counterterrorism efforts by federal, state, and local agencies. He also established the Homeland Security Council to provide the president with advice on homeland security-related issues.

Eleven days after the terrorist assault on September 11, 2001, President George W. Bush established the Office of Homeland Security. The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) oversees the movement of people and goods into and out of the United States as well as the protection of our nation's borders. Bush established the White House Office of Homeland Security immediately after the catastrophe in an effort to revamp the country's security, intelligence, and emergency response systems to stop additional killing on American soil. The Agency of Homeland Security officially opened its doors in November 2002 after the Homeland Security Act was passed by Congress, creating it as a separate Cabinet-level department to further coordinate and streamline national homeland security initiatives.

What is judicial review in simple words?

Answers

Judicial review in simple words is a kind of court proceeding where a judge reviews the lawfulness of an action or a decision decided by a public body.

Who can conduct a judicial review?

Someone with a sufficient interest in a decision may appeal for a judicial review. This precondition is interpreted liberally. The traditional reasons for judicial review are illegality, irrationality and procedural impropriety. These premises may overlap and are flexible.

As an example, if the Congress were to pass a law forbidding newspapers from printing information related to certain political issues, the courts would have the authority to rule which this law violates the First Amendment, and is consequently unconstitutional.

Can you refuse to testify in court as a witness?

Answers

In order to avoid being charged with criminal contempt of court, the individual who is involved as a material witness must state their valid reason for declining to testify.

Can you decline to provide a witness statement in court?

The evidence would implicate you - You have the right to withhold any information that could be used against you in an investigation under the Fifth Amendment of the Constitution. You can typically invoke the Fifth Amendment, which gives you the right to decline to answer questions.

Can you choose not to testify?

The Fifth Amendment states that no one "shall be required in any criminal prosecution to be a witness against themselves." Courts have interpreted witnesses' rights in criminal cases to imply that may decline to testify on the grounds that they could be involved in criminal activity.
